Amanda: What’s the hardest cake you’ve ever made?

Farah: I faced difficulty in covering my cake with marzipan for the first time as the texture is quite different from fondant. But because it tastes great, I always use marzipan to cover most of my birthday cakes and they are loved by everyone.
